JAMB: Nnewi indigene emerges best overall candidate in 2023 UTME

 

Yemi Obafemi

 

Joy Mmesoma Ejikeme, a student at the Anglican Girls Secondary School Nnewi (AGSS), has emerged the overall best student in the 2023 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ination, UTME organized by Joint Admission Matriculation Board with an aggregate score of 362 .

 

She received the following grades: Chemistry -81, Biology -94, Physics -89, and Use of English -98.

 

Following the outstanding performance, Prof Ngozi Chuma-Udeh, the Commissioner of Education for Anambra State, praised Ms. Ejikeme’s extraordinary achievement, calling it “excellent and very outstanding.”

 

According to the Commissioner, success has once again shown how much the government of Governor Chukwuma Charles Soludo has invested in and prioritized the State’s educational system.

 

“This outstanding performance of Ejikeme has indeed brought joy and happiness to every Ndi-Anambra. We are proud of her and we will monitor her academic progression as she pursues whatever career she desires”

 

‘We are proud of her and grateful to Governor Soludo for giving top priority to education in the state”.  She added. (a.naedo.com)
